What is a Ryobi Lawn Edger?

A Ryobi lawn edger is a handheld power tool that uses a rotating blade to cut a clean edge along the borders of your lawn. The blade is typically made of steel or carbide, and it's mounted on a shaft that can be adjusted to different heights.

Ryobi lawn edgers are available in both corded and cordless models. Corded models are typically more powerful, but they require an outlet to be used. Cordless models are more portable, but they have a shorter battery life.

How to Use a Ryobi Lawn Edger

Using a Ryobi lawn edger is relatively simple. First, make sure that the blade is sharp and that the tool is properly assembled. Then, adjust the blade height to the desired setting.

To start edging, simply walk along the border of your lawn, keeping the blade close to the ground. The blade will cut through any weeds or grasses that are in its path, creating a clean, crisp edge.

If you're edging around a flower bed or other obstacle, you may need to use the tool's edge guide. The edge guide is a metal bar that attaches to the tool and helps you to keep the blade at a consistent distance from the obstacle.

Once you've finished edging, be sure to clean the blade and store the tool in a safe place.
